As the needs of our homes evolve and develop, we’re looking for new ways to make open-plan spaces more multifunctional without compromising the open, sociable feel. This is the perfect opportunity to utilise our pattern floor as it can either be laid in a rug pattern within our wood floors or with a wood border. Creating zones and borders can help to reimagine a space that can be adapted as needed.
For example, if you’re working from home why not create a cosy office nook in the kitchen that can be transformed back into a dining table once the weekend rolls around. The floor creates a sense of an area, separating work and family life in this scenario. Not only is this a more practical use of space, but it also doesn’t compromise on style, allowing you to experiment with creative patterns and colour whilst still maintaining a cohesive interior scheme.
